Murphy's Haystacks

Eyre Peninsula & the West Coast


A few kilometres down the Point Labatt road are the globular Murphy's Haystacks, an improbable congregation of 'inselbergs' − colourful, weather-sculpted granite outcrops that are an estimated 1500 million years old.
